
The Concert Band is a performance based ensemble that emphasizes advancing musicianship and playing techniques of students. Concert Band students have the opportunity to perform both classic and contemporary music literature. The Concert Band performs in two concerts per year and rehearses two times per cycle during activity period. Concert Band is a graded class that meets during activity periods. Students also attend group lessons throughout the day. Anyone with previous instrumental music experience (Flute, Clarinet, Oboe, Bassoon, Saxophone, French Horn, Trumpet, Trombone, Baritone, Tuba, and Percussion) is encouraged to join.

The Jazz Band is an audition only performance based ensemble that emphasizes advancing musicianship and playing techniques of students. Jazz Band students have the opportunity to perform many different style of music within the genre of “jazz.” (Blues, Funk, Latin, Rock) The Jazz Band performs in two concerts per year as well as several other community functions. The Jazz Band rehearses twice a cycle during activity period as well as after school on Tuesdays. Jazz Band is a graded class that meets during activity periods. Anyone with previous instrumental jazz experience (Saxophone, Trumpet, Trombone, Piano, Guitar, Bass, and Drum set) is encouraged to audition.

The Chorus is a performance based ensemble that emphasizes advancing musicianship and singing techniques of students. Chorus students have the opportunity to perform both classic and contemporary choral literature. The Chorus performs in two concerts per year and rehearses two times per cycle during activity period. Chorus is a graded class that meets during activity periods. Students also attend group lessons throughout the day. Anyone with previous vocal music performance experience is encouraged to join.

The Chamber Singers is an audition only performance based ensemble that emphasizes advancing musicianship and singing techniques of students. Chamber Singers have the opportunity to perform both classic and contemporary choral literature. The Chamber Singers perform in two concerts per year as well as several other community functions. The chamber singers rehearse after school on Wednesdays. Anyone with previous vocal music performance experience is encouraged to audition.

The Marching Band performs their field show at home and away football games, as well as serving as a pep band. In addition to football games the Marching Band actively participates in the United States Scholastic Band Association competition circuit, as well as local Marching Band adjudications. The marching band also participates in local community parades throughout the fall season. The Marching Band rehearses after school on Monday, Wednesday, and Thursday during the fall sports season. Anyone with previous Marching Band experience (Flute, Clarinet, Oboe, Bassoon, Saxophone, French Horn, Trumpet, Trombone, Baritone, Tuba, Percussion, and Color Guard) is encouraged to join.
